Ingredients You’ll Need for Best Marry Me Salmon
- 4 salmon fillets
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/3 cup sun-dried tomatoes, chopped
- 3/4 cup heavy cream
- 1/3 cup chicken broth
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
How to Make Best Marry Me Salmon
- Pat the salmon fillets dry and season them with salt and pepper, letting the aroma of the sea inspire your culinary adventure.
- In a skillet, heat the olive oil over medium-high heat. Sear the salmon fillets, flesh-side down, for 4-5 minutes until they are beautifully golden and crisp. Flip them over and cook for another 2-3 minutes until they reach a lovely shade of pink inside. Remove the salmon and set aside, letting the flavors savor the air.
- In the same skillet, reduce the heat to medium and add minced garlic and chopped sun-dried tomatoes. Sauté for 1-2 minutes until the kitchen fills with the tantalizing aroma of garlic.
- Pour in the chicken broth, letting it simmer for just 1 minute while you prepare for creamy indulgence.
- Stir in the heavy cream and Parmesan cheese, allowing the mixture to bubble and thicken for 3-4 minutes until it achieves that perfect creamy consistency.
- Add in the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per, adjusting to your preferred taste. The medley of flavors will make your heart sing!
- Return the salmon to the skillet, gently spooning the luscious sauce over the fillets. Let it simmer together for 3-5 minutes until the salmon is cooked through and the sauce has embraced it perfectly.
- Turn off the heat, garnish with fresh parsley, and serve immediately! The colorful plate will elevate your dining experience as you gather around to enjoy this cozy creation.
Delicious Variations to Try
- Zesty Lemon Burst: Add a splash of lemon juice and zest to the sauce for a refreshing zing that brightens the dish.
- Herbed Delight: Incorporate fresh herbs like dill or basil into the sauce for an earthy flavor that complements the salmon beautifully.
- Spicy Kick: Stir in a pinch of red pepper flakes for a mild heat that adds a thrilling layer to the dish.
- Veggie Medley: Toss in fresh spinach or kale into the sauce for added color and nutrients, making this dish even more wholesome.
Chef Emma’s Helpful Tips
- Make Ahead: Prepare the sauce ahead of time and store it in the fridge. Just reheat it gently before adding your cooked salmon for a quick weeknight meal.
- Salmon Substitute: If you’re in the mood for something different, this sauce pairs well with chicken breasts or shrimp too! Simply adjust cooking times accordingly.
- Storage Suggestions: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. Reheat gently on the stove or microwave.
- Perfect Slicing: When serving your salmon, use a sharp knife to slice through to maintain the beautiful texture and allure of each fillet.
